Why You'll Love Beaverton:
Beaverton, Oregon, is a vibrant, family-friendly city nestled in the heart of the picturesque Pacific Northwest. Located just seven miles west of Portland, Beaverton offers the perfect balance of urban convenience and outdoor adventure , making it an exceptional place to live and work. Despite being one of Oregon's largest cities, it retains a close-knit, small-town charm that residents and newcomers alike appreciate. Surrounded by lush forests, rolling hills, and stunning landscapes, Beaverton is a gateway to outdoor activities . The city is home to over 100 parks and 30 miles of hiking trails , where you can enjoy serene walks, birdwatching, and exploring native wildlife. Whether you're into biking, running, or simply soaking up the beauty of the Pacific Northwest, Beaverton offers countless ways to connect with nature.
Beaverton boasts a dynamic food scene with a mix of global flavors and local flair. From its celebrated Beaverton Farmers Market -one of the largest in the state-to a growing number of craft breweries, food carts, and farm-to-table restaurants, there's something to satisfy every palate. As home to top-rated schools and a short drive from world-class universities like Oregon State University and the University of Portland, Beaverton is a fantastic place to raise a family. Additionally, it's a hub for innovation, being the headquarters of Nike, Columbia Sportswear, and other major companies, which foster a thriving local economy and vibrant professional community.
Beaverton's prime location offers easy access to Portland's cultural attractions, including art galleries, theaters, and live music venues. You're also less than two hours from the Oregon Coast , the stunning Columbia River Gorge , and the iconic Mount Hood , making weekend getaways effortless.

Route Details:

Dedicated Dollar Tree Ridgefield, WA is actively seeking solo drivers. All freight is dry. Successful candidates will be responsible for manually unloading trailers with rollers, averaging 2-4 loads with 3-4 stops per load. The designated route starts in Ridgefield, WA, running through regional Washington, Oregon, Idaho, Utah, Montana, and Northern California. Drivers must have a safe, authorized place to park the truck if they live more than 50 miles away from Ridgefield, WA. Dollar Tree Facility - 8400 South Union Ridge Parkway, Ridgefield, WA 98642.

Weekly home time with a 34-hour reset. Days off vary. This lane has both day and night shifts, with no set shift. During the holiday season, there might be less time off. Based on freight demands during other times, there could be additional time off. This account is great for drivers who enjoy combining driving with hands-on work!

We’re hiring Paramedics in Washington County that are passionate about delivering compassionate, high-quality service and basic, as well as advanced, patient care to our customers.





RESPONSIBILITIES

- Assess each call situation to determine the best course of action while working with progressive Paramedic protocols.
- Utilize your Paramedic skills on medical equipment and procedures including defibrillator, EKG monitor, oxygen and suction devices, and intravenous fluids to provide advanced medical care.
- Communicate with patients and loved ones to provide information and assurance that care is being given.
- Act as Paramedic team leader and take responsibility for the scene and unit management as needed.
- Drive the ambulance on 911 responses.
- Work collaboratively and in a professional manner with all allied health and public safety personnel as well as your fellow Paramedics.



M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S

- High school diploma or equivalent (GED)
- Oregon State Paramedic License
- State Driver’s License
- BLS, ACLS, PALS, PHTLS
- ICS 100, 200, 700, 800
- Driving record in compliance with company policy
- Pass Physical Agility Test
- Some work experience, preferably in healthcare

The Opportunity

Solarcore is an advanced materials technology company that develops the most scientifically innovative thermal solutions on the planet. We are on a mission to solve the world’s largest thermal efficiency problems by revolutionizing the antiquated world of thermal insulation.


Solarcore is looking for an experienced Government Product Line Manager (PLM) to support our expansion into United States Government business, including Department of Defense contracts and federal procurement. This person must be well-versed in navigating the complex world of government contracting, compliance, and logistics.


The ideal candidate will have a deep understanding of government sales, defense procurement cycles, and must have a proven track record of securing & supporting government contracts while working within the DoD Procurement Processes.


As our Government PLM, you will need to be passionate about creating new to the world solutions across a wide variety of applications, ensuring that our products align with federal procurement standards, and developing and managing the stage gate process to smoothly move products from the ideation to the final commercialization phase.


This position will report to the VP of Product and will be a main point of contact for the entire Solarcore executive team.


Key Responsibilities

·      Work with Solarcore's Government Business Development Team, OEMs, and Program Managers to understand requirements for success for all government projects and communicate this to the PD team.

·      Understanding of Mil-spec requirements and standardized testing methods such as (ASTM, ISO, Oeko Tex, NFPA).

·      Manage product responses to RFPs, RFQs, and government solicitations, ensuring competitive, compliant proposals.

·      Develop and maintain relationships with OEMs and Program Managers across multiple channels.

·      Manage the full life cycle with OEM partners to ensure continued success.

·      Ensure our products are built to compliance standards (Berry Amendment, FAR , DFARS, etc.).

·      Assist in developing pricing strategies for contracts of all sizes.

·      Assist in 5-year planning and product roadmap for all government needs.

·      Assist in creating standalone material and full application validations by designing DOEs.

·      Lead internal stage gate process for the government channel.

·      Track, understand, and summarize competitor products, markets, and pricing.

·      Attend industry events, sales meetings, and supplier visits.

·      Assist in preparing for government audits and performance reviews.


 Experience and Requirements


·      5+ years of experience in government sales, contracting, or compliance, ideally in DoD, aerospace, defense, or advanced materials.

·      3+ years of project management in government sales, contracting, or compliance, ideally in DoD, aerospace, defense, or advanced materials.

·      5+ Experience working with military or defense agencies & prime contractors.

·      Active security clearance or the ability to obtain one is required.

·      Ability to coordinate with cross-functional teams (Sales, R&D, Operations, Legal, and Finance) to ensure compliance and execution.

·      Strong understanding of defense apparel, military cold-weather gear, or industrial insulation applications is a plus.

·      Passion for building things from the ground up and continued improvement of both products and processes.
